Quick Assessment
This early reader biography introduces young children to Jennifer Aniston, focusing on her career as an actress best known for her role in the television show "Friends." Suitable for ages 5-8, it provides an accessible glimpse into the life of a popular figure in entertainment without complex themes or mature content.
